如何修改macOS系統的界面元素,怎么修改macOS系統的界面元素,對于想自己修改圖標等的伙伴來說,不會修改是個麻煩事,小編在這里告訴大家怎么修改macOS系統的界面元素,如何修改macOS系統的界面元素。
對于 Mac 用戶來說,常見的個人修改界面的對象包括應用程序圖標、文件夾圖標、菜單欄右邊的狀態(tài)菜單圖標整理、Dock背景、登錄界面背景、開機 Logo 和關于本機系統圖標等。
日前有伙伴分享了一個修改 macOS 系統的菜單欄圖標、通知按鈕以及界面其他元素的操作辦法,他表示,這些元素是比較難以修改的。下面我們來了解一下具體情況。
1. 這些較難修改的界面元素在哪里?
常見的圖標等元素在應用程序包里面,例如“信息”的應用圖標、音效在 /Applications/Messages.app/Contents/Resources 目錄下。
由于系統、自帶軟件的功能、界面圖標很多是相同的,所以不在某一軟件包內,而是封裝在系統深處的某一文件內,較難修改的圖標元素通常以 png、pdf 等格式存在于后綴為 .framework、.bundle、.app 的文件夾內,通常還封裝在 .car 格式文件內。
界面元素實在太多,具體要修改哪個元素還需要慢慢找,要找封裝在 .car 格式文件內的元素,在路徑 /System下搜索 .car 即可,但很多 .car 文件保存在 .framework、.bundle、.app 內。另外,與界面有關的這些文件基本上都在以下幾個路徑:
/System/Library/CoreServices 下的 .app 內和 .bundle 內;
/System/Library/Frameworks 下的 .framework 內;
/System/Library/PrivateFrameworks 下的 .framework 內;
2. 怎么修改?
macOS 10.12 系統配有系統完整性保護功能,簡稱 SIP,因此要修改系統文件先要關閉 SIP。在 .app、.bundle、.framework 文件上直接右鍵顯示包內容/在新標簽頁打開,打開 .car 文件要使用外國大神 alexzielenski 的工具軟件 ThemeEngine.app。
下面舉例說明:
小編推薦閱讀